Ex‑Love Review — Review Ex-Love Review is a romance that doesn’t rush to comfort you. Instead of dramatic twists or instant redemption, it focuses on the uncomfortable space where past feelings resurface and refuse to stay quiet. What makes this manhwa compelling is its emotional honesty. The story doesn’t treat an ex-relationship as something easily revisited or neatly resolved. Every conversation feels weighted with history, regret, and things left unsaid. The characters aren’t trying to recreate the past—they’re trying to understand it. The pacing is deliberate, sometimes slow, but purposeful. Rather than pushing the plot forward with big events, the manhwa relies on tension built through subtle interactionsand emotional hesitation. That restraint makes the moments of confrontation hit harder when they finally arrive.

Ex-Love Review works best for readers who enjoy character-driven stories. It’s less about falling in love again and more about confronting why love failed in the first place. Quiet, reflective, and emotionally grounded, it’s a story that lingers rather than explodes.
